Vorschrift
3,4-Ethylenedioxythiophene-2,5-dicarboxylic acid (460 g) and a copper powder (46 g) were added to DMSO (1200 g) at room temperature. The reaction mixture was stirred under an oxygen atmosphere for 30 minutes at room temperature and then heated at 120° C. for 6 hours. The reaction mixture was then poured into ice water (1200 mL), and the crude product was extracted with ethyl acetate. After drying over anhydrous sodium sulfate, the solvent was removed by evaporation. The residue was vacuum-distilled at 30 mmHg to give 283 g of 3,4-ethylenedioxythiophene at high purity (99.7% or higher). The purity was confirmed by gas chromatographic analysis (compared to decane as an internal standard). The chemical structure was confirmed by mass analysis and 1H-NMR.
